Jesse Griffin
Jesse Griffin is an actor, comedian, writer and director who has worked in New Zealand, Australia and the UK since the mid-1990s. Originally training in physical theatre at Melbourne’s John Bolton Theatre School, he co-founded acclaimed physical comedy group The 4 Noels, who earned multiple comedy awards at numerous international comedy festivals, including the Edinburgh Fringe.
Jesse is perhaps best known to New Zealand audiences for his award-winning comedy creation Wilson Dixon, the deadpan American country musician who became a familiar face through appearances on 7 Days, the NZ International Comedy Festival, and multiple national tours.
A highly experienced creative with a deep understanding of comedic timing, performance and story, Jesse is the co-creator and director of NZ comedy series Educators, which has received multiple award nominations and international recognition at the New York Festivals TV & Film Awards. Acting credits include Nude Tuesday, 800 Words and the soon to be released feature Klara and the Sun - while his directing work includes Amazon’s The Office Australia and TVNZ’s Talkback.
Jesse moves easily between acting, directing, improvisation and scripted comedy, bringing his intelligence and unique perspective to every project.
